      Exeter are a bit different tho. I mean there are people out there that are convinced that because Newcastle were an established prem team they'll be able to mimic what quins and saints did after their relations, problem there is they both had much better teams when they went down and managed to keep most if not all of their better players and then strengthened when they came back up. 
       
      A team like Worcester imploding or a team like Bedford winning the championship will be the only things saving Newcastle. I can see them becoming a bit like Rotherham/Leeds of a a few years back where they yoyoed up and down, clearly too good for the league below but not quite good enough for the prem.

                Bit of a stuttering performance by Wales this morning. Not surprising with such a young side, new-look coaching team for the tour, and so on, but at least they got the win. Japan were never going to be a pushover, and they looked the better side for much of the game. Wasn't convinced by the decision to leave Navidi out, or the decision to take Biggar off when they did, but in the end it was job done, and a couple of the youngsters looked like good prospects for the future - Emyr Phillips had a great game at hooker, I thought.
                 
                What's with the idea of not having a TMO for a full international, though?!!
